Unlock Your Royal Reels Treasure!

Prepare to soar into a world of glittering spin with Royal Reels! This enchanting slot machine is your key to untold riches. With every whirl, you'll embark on a quest for fabulous wins. The reels are spinning with excitement, waiting to spin you with golden spin. Challenge your luck and see if fortune smiles upon you. Immerse in a royal spin lik

read more